p_value.BFBayesFactor: p-values for Bayesian Models

Description

This function attempts to return, or compute, p-values of Bayesian models.

Usage

# S3 method for BFBayesFactor
p_value(model, ...)

Arguments

model

A statistical model.

...

Arguments passed down to standard_error_robust() when confidence intervals or p-values based on robust standard errors should be computed. Only available for models where method = "robust" is supported.

Value

The p-values.

Details

For Bayesian models, the p-values corresponds to the probability of direction (p_direction), which is converted to a p-value using bayestestR::convert_pd_to_p().
